With the arrival of winter and the continuous drop in temperature, the low-temperature environment brings many adverse effects to the construction of concrete pumps. Concrete is prone to freezing at low temperatures, resulting in poor fluidity and even making it impossible to pump; at the same time, low temperatures also affect the strength and durability of concrete, increasing construction difficulty and costs. Therefore, proper preparation before construction is especially important! Below, we will introduce the specific anti-freezing measures for pump trucks before construction.

01 Equipment Cold Protection and Insulation
First, a comprehensive inspection of the concrete pump should be conducted to ensure that all components are intact, especially critical parts such as the engine and hydraulic system. At the same time, add fuel and lubricating oil suitable for winter use to the equipment to prevent starting difficulties or operational malfunctions due to low temperatures. In addition, the equipment's cooling system needs to be insulated to prevent accidents such as the water tank freezing and cracking.
02 Pipeline Insulation Measures
The conveying pipeline is a crucial component of the concrete pump and one of the parts most susceptible to low temperatures. Therefore, it is essential to implement rigorous insulation measures for the pipeline, such as wrapping it with insulation materials, to reduce heat loss and ensure that the concrete maintains a suitable temperature during transportation.
03. Preheating Treatment of Raw Materials
The main raw materials for concrete include cement, aggregates, and water. In low-temperature environments, the temperature of these raw materials will also decrease, affecting the performance of the concrete. Therefore, the raw materials should be preheated before construction, for example, by mixing the concrete with hot water to raise its temperature to a suitable range, ensuring the mixing quality and pump-ability of the concrete.
04. Adjusting the Mix Proportion and Admixtures
Given the characteristics of winter construction, it is necessary to appropriately adjust the concrete mix proportions and add admixtures that can improve the concrete's frost resistance and early strength. This can, to some extent, compensate for the adverse effects of low temperatures on concrete performance.
05. Strengthen Construction Monitoring
During construction, it is essential to strengthen the monitoring of key indicators such as concrete temperature and slump. If any abnormalities are detected, immediate measures should be taken to adjust the situation, ensuring that the construction quality of the concrete remains under control at all times.
In conclusion, preparations before using concrete pumps in winter are crucial. Only by fully considering the characteristics of winter construction, carefully carrying out all preparatory work, and strictly controlling every step can we effectively avoid quality accidents, ensure the smooth progress of the project, and lay a solid foundation for the safety and stability of the building.
